John Liew is one of the founders of AQR, a private hedge fund firm based in Greenwich, Connecticut. The firm was founded in 1998 by Cliff Asness, David G. Kabiller, Robert Krail and John Liew. The firm focuses on traditional and alternative investment strategies and has $224 billion assets under management. AQR operates globally with 900 employees and offices in London, Sydney and Hong Kong. Before cofounding AQR, Liew worked at Goldman Sachs as a portfolio manager, where he developed and managed quantitative trading strategies. He created the Liew College Fellows Fund to finance undergraduates who have unpaid research opportunities with the University of Chicago's faculty. He earned a B.A. in economics from the University of Chicago, where he was elected a member of Phi Beta Kappa, and went on to earn an M.B.A. and a Ph.D. in finance, also from Chicago.
